Output 330238fc24ef55da660fb5aa73ad2ccc172282dbe61a14cd497fcc34d4cffacf:0

value
6139963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d042194b464a3512c853e2115bee90ed5ae53e OP_EQUALVERIFY OP_CHECKSIG
address
18TbDa9m4bt5tApFVGKuLPst32kVAVrhuU
transaction
330238fc24ef55da660fb5aa73ad2ccc172282dbe61a14cd497fcc34d4cffacf
confirmations
430627
spent
true